Block 570,063

Block Hash

99a012c02bdfa4a6446818eb869752229f14f347b15ef1d13cd4003fab3a14a9

Previous Block Hash

4cc29b4d374292db4679a961791c954fba2522b73fb4557d5254ba3191fcac79

Mined

Transactions

3

Difficulty

43.68 M

Size

769 bytes

Transactions (3)

1 input, 1 output
15,625.01226 PEPE
1 input, 2 outputs
270.01862282 PEPE